Frequently Asked Questions

What are all the color codes for HSL(0, 20%, 90%)?

HEX: #EBE0E0 | RGB: rgb(235, 224, 224) | CMYK: 0%, 5%, 5%, 8% | HSV: 0°, 5%, 92%. Copy any format from the conversion table above.

What colors go well with #EBE0E0?

The complementary color is HSL(180, 20%, 90%). For a triadic harmony, use hues 0°, 120°, and 240°. For analogous combinations, try hues 330° and 30°. See the Color Harmony section above for complete palettes with previews.

How do I use HSL(0, 20%, 90%) in CSS?

As HSL: color: hsl(0, 20%, 90%); — As HEX: color: #EBE0E0; — As RGB: color: rgb(235, 224, 224); — Tailwind CSS: bg-[hsl(0,20%,90%)] — CSS variable: --color-primary: hsl(0, 20%, 90%);
